A beautiful sculptural Mid-Century cork screw bottle opener in the shape of a big key. This is a rare and not common model, designed by Carl Aubock, executed by the Carl Aubock workshop in Vienna, Austria. Large, it is 6 1/4“ long. A vintage piece from the 1950s, made of solid brass, gently polished, in good condition with marginal signs of wear.
